Camouflaj Reveals New Exciting Features And Locations of Iron Man VR

Though Iron Man VR had to endure a lot of delays it’s happy news that finally it is going to release next month. Ryan Payton has explained in PlayStation Blog that there were many fans need a VR game with definitely the best storyline. Payton says Iron Man VR would provide a comprehensive narrative about Tony Stark, and it will take about four to five hours to finish the campaign before recent test results are available. Based on the results, however, Payton says the anticipated playtime is about double the original.

Several areas on PlayStation Blog are also shown which include areas of Marvel’s actual places. Short videos are seen at sites like the S.H.I.E.L.D. helicarriere, the Stark decommissioned facility, and the city of Shanghai. The Shanghai video reveals the beautiful scenery and what it feels like to zip around the Iron Man skyscraper at fast speeds. Participants could also feel the suit in the playable demo, which provided participants with a glimpse of flight, combat, and the HUD 3D.

Ryan Payton additionally uncovers more insights regarding the flying and battle by giving fans a glance at how extraordinary amour features will function. Highlights, for example, the Unibeam, rocket punches, and optional weapons are flaunted in energizing activity. Payton additionally flaunts highlights for development like lifts and an incredibly cool-looking “Ground Pound”, which dispatches the player toward the ground for a devastating attack from above.

Iron Man VR will be released on July 3rd on PSVR.
